A vibrant illustration to be colored, then unfolded to reveal a beautiful artwork nearly five feet long.
An adventure for sophisticated colorists, this contemporary coloring frieze invites you to join illustrator Meel Tamphanon as she celebrates the beloved stories of The Arabian Nights in a striking concertina format. Sheherezade, Aladdin, Ali Baba, Sindbad, and more are reimagined through Tamphanon's opulent, intricate line work, designed for both mindful coloring and display.
The frieze consists of:
- A beautifully giftable, robust wraparound cover
- A paper frieze, concertinäfolded, showcasing Tamphanon's richly detailed illustration on heavy art paper
- Ten A5 panels when folded (8¿" high × 5¿" wide), unfolding into a spectacular continuous artwork measuring just under five feet long
Color page by page, then unfold the frieze to experience The Arabian Nights as a single, immersive visual journey.

Meel Tamphanon is a freelance illustrator from Phuket, Thailand. Her clients include 20th Century Studios, Disney, Magic the Gathering, the Boston Globe and Corriere della Sera. Her work is related to surreal, mythological, and historical subjects in children’s book illustration and editorial.
